Smart Grid Technologies

The content explores advanced energy management systems characterized by the integration of renewable energy sources, enhanced efficiency, and sustainability through smart grid technologies. It addresses key topics such as the use of IoT in energy monitoring, the impact of smart meters, cybersecurity challenges, and global initiatives for interconnecting energy grids. Further investigations include hybrid learning models for intrusion detection systems, energy trading using blockchain, and the development of smart infrastructure to meet growing electricity demand driven by urbanization and population growth.
